This is an end terraced 1930s building, which was originally a bank - it is now a cafe/bar. The frontage is of brick, with a glass and grey extended lower - some of which appear, from the inside, to be retractable doors. The interior is in brick and a snotty green colour, with a wood floor. The walls are filled with eclectic pictures and, other than a few sofas, the room is populated by wood tables that are part stained in blues/pinks etc. It is a cafe by day (when i visited) so had a family feel, with cake and birthday party balloons etc. I didn't see a TV and the music was easy and at a decent level. The service was fine. After the General's review below, i wish i had visited later, as i felt a tad out of place at my visit. Beer; a few tap drinks, nut i noticed the Bath Ale's Toga Man, so had that - it was a little cloudy, but tasted fine (didn't notice at first as a bit gloomy inside). Happy i popped in, but if i went back it would be later on an evening.

This is a relatively new café/bar which has opened, I believe, within the last two years. It is situated in a converted bath showroom. As such, the layout is square with an undressed brick wall on the right as you enter. The frontage and the left hand wall are made from plate glass. The bar is situated on the rear wall to the right. It is open plan and boarded, with stripped wooden tables.
We arrived on a Sunday at 5:00ish on 22 December. It was fairly quiet, but filled out as time went on.
We were a party of four, and we all ate. Three of us had home made soup, which was delicious, followed by nine servings of tapas, which we shared. This was delicious. The fourth member of the party had a hot dog, which was huge and, I am told, delicious.
We discovered that Sunday is Quiz Night, so we stayed and joined in, though we lost, coming eighth, out of 16 teams.
Beer wise, the place does not serve Carling, or Carlsberg and frowns on shots like Jagerbombs. It does serve lager, such as Stella and Estrella. It also serves Bath Ales Dark Side on Smooth, which I believe is a Stout or Dark Mild. The only real ale is All Hail the Ale Toga Man, which I was told is a rebranded Bristol Ale. The Dark Side and Toga Man were really nice.
I found the service to be extremely friendly, all the staff taking time to speak with their customers without being obtrusive. It is not cheap, but then, neither is it outrageously expensive.
The unpubby Mrs Staal insists that I mention that the place serves tea, coffee and hot chocolate all day and has an array of cakes available on the counter. She really liked the place too.
Despite its layout and food, the place is somewhere in which you can sit and enjoy your pint or two...or coffees.
This is a highly recommended café/bar.
